657: Everything You've Been Too Embarrassed to Ask Your Accountant
Q: What should studio owners be thinking about concerning CEO compensation?
They should establish a consistent payment based on cash flow and ensure that as their income increases, they are also adequately compensated for their work.
657: Everything You've Been Too Embarrassed to Ask Your Accountant
Q: How does a studio owner determine between a contractor and an employee?
The owner should look at IRS guidelines about schedule control, independent decision-making, and specific duties to determine the classification.
657: Everything You've Been Too Embarrassed to Ask Your Accountant
Q: What should an owner be thinking about when it comes to taxes in general?
An owner should understand the types of taxes they're responsible for and the importance of having financial support to manage those taxes effectively.

Frequently Asked Questions About The Business of Boutique Fitness

What is The Business of Boutique Fitness about and what kind of topics does it cover?

Focused on the niche of boutique fitness management, this podcast offers actionable strategies and insights tailored for studio owners seeking to enhance their business operations. The host discusses various topics including effective sales techniques, navigating uncomfortable conversations within studio teams, and the importance of customer experience and community engagement. Episodes frequently feature industry leaders sharing their experiences and best practices, making this podcast a valuable resource for those in the fitness sector looking to elevate their businesses and foster a supportive studio culture.
